## Further reading

The Saltmere tide-table widget caches predictions for 48 hours and falls back to the Brackenport model when the primary feed lags. Most support tickets trace to stale caches or timezone drift on embedded displays. Before escalating, confirm the widget's data timestamp and station ID. Cache-flush steps, known display quirks, and the station lookup table are documented on the page below.

wiki page, tahaf-tajog: https://jira.ordindyn.corp/pipeline

RUNBOOK — Grovewiki account recovery (RBAC lockout)

Symptom: admin loses Editor-Admin role after a failed directory sync; wiki shows read-only for everyone. Do not re-run the sync. Steps: stop the sync agent, snapshot the roles table, restore the last known-good role map from the Hollowbay replica, restart Grovewiki. Verify one admin can edit before re-enabling sync. If the role map restore itself prompts for elevated recovery mode, you'll need the break-glass passphrase, which appears directly below.

strongbox words: norwyn-wenael-aldvan-aldiel-wendor-holael

Key Ceremony Checklist — Item 7 (Cronwright Migration)

[ ] Before cutover from legacy cron to the Lattice workflow engine, seal the scheduler signing key. Verify both witnesses from the Harbrook release team are present. Confirm all migrated jobs are paused in Lattice and the legacy crontab snapshot is archived. Record the ceremony timestamp in the migration log. Once the key shard is sealed, the escrow officer reads out the recovery passphrase, which is recorded immediately below this item.

vault phrase of tawig-taduf = zorath-oliwyn

Vendor note: our wiki (Notewell, hosted by Cartafold Ltd.) uses role-based access managed on the vendor side. Contractors get the "external-editor" role by default, which excludes finance and HR spaces. Role changes require a ticket approved by your sponsoring manager; self-service upgrades are disabled per contract. Expect one business day turnaround. For access errors or role questions, contact the Cartafold account desk.

alerts address for yajof-kahog: eliax@qirvanlabs.corp